tools/nolibc: compiler: use attribute((naked)) if available
The current entrypoint attributes optimize("Os", "omit-frame-pointer")
are intended to avoid all compiler generated code, like function
porologue and epilogue.
This is the exact usecase implemented by the attribute "naked".
Unfortunately this is not implemented by GCC for all targets,
so only use it where available.
This also provides compatibility with clang, which recognizes the
"naked" attribute but not the previously used attribute "optimized".
